The primary purposes of pool chemicals are to control the pH levels, sanitize the water, and prevent algae growth. Each type plays a vital role in maintaining the overall health of your pool.Sanitizers are the first line of defense against bacteria and other microorganisms in your pool. Chlorine is the most commonly used sanitizer, available in various forms such as liquid, granular, or tablet. If you're looking for a gentler option, bromine is also a popular choice and releases fewer odors. For those sensitive to chlorine, saltwater systems offer an excellent alternative, providing automatic chlorine generation without the harsh effects.Balancers are equally important, as they help in maintaining the right pH level in your pool water. A balanced pH level, ideally between 7.4 and 7.6, ensures the effectiveness of sanitizers and prevents pool equipment corrosion. Products such as pH increasers, decreasers, and alkalinity adjusters are commonly used to keep the water chemically balanced.Algaecides are another essential group of chemicals that prevent and control algae growth. Depending on the type and severity of the algae, different products are available. It's advisable to choose algaecides that are compatible with your pool's sanitizer, whether it's chlorine-based or involves a saltwater system, to maximize effectiveness.Shock treatments should not be overlooked when maintaining your pool. These potent oxidizers help clear cloudy water, kill bacteria, and eliminate unpleasant odors. Generally, shocking your pool once a week is sufficient, though it may vary based on usage and environmental factors. Additionally, consider any allergies or sensitivities your family might have and choose products that align with those needs.Lastly, storage and handling of pool chemicals should always be done with care. Keep them in a cool, dry place, away from direct sunlight and moisture, and ensure they are out of reach of children and pets. Always follow the manufacturer's instructions for use, and never mix different chemicals, as this can lead to hazardous reactions.In conclusion, selecting the right pool chemicals involves understanding your pool's unique needs and adhering to a regular maintenance schedule.
